A versatile high-performance e-mobility platform
High-performance, scalable e-mobility modules like the RoadPak™ and other silicon carbide (SiC) semiconductors offer significant efficiency gains in the electric vehicle (EV) powertrain. They drive e-mobility applications like e-vehicles and e-buses, which are more in demand than ever, following governmental and global initiatives for renewable and sustainable mobility.
To meet these demands, Hitachi Energy developed RoadPak, a versatile e-mobility platform that is optimized to deliver the highest performance and reliability. It achieves this by using up to 10 SiC chips in parallel, supporting for various chipsets of different generations from various suppliers.
